    The Science of Stress with Dr. Chris Lee

    Play Episode Listen Later Mar 1, 2023 43:05


    The time between trauma and the manifestation of mental health challenges is about 18 months, says Dr. Chris Lee, founder & CEO of Elemental Shift. With the global trauma of the pandemic, we are now seeing massive spikes in anxiety, mental health issues, domestic violence and more.  This week, he explains the science of stress, as well as knowing how much stress you can tolerate every day, learning how to self-regulate, and the importance of rest after heavy cognitive lifting. There are two types of trauma – big T Trauma and little t trauma. Dr. Chris Lee discusses the differences and how there is a level of stimulus we can tolerate each day before it becomes stress.     The Genetics of Sleep with Dr. Michael Breus

    Play Episode Listen Later Jan 25, 2023 49:02


    Whether you are a morning person or someone that snoozes multiple times before waking, how you sleep is all due to genetics. Dr. Michael Breus is a clinical psychologist and expert in sleep and insomnia. Today, he discusses the four chronotypes –  the types of sleepers. Instead of early bird or night owl, are you a lion, wolf, bear, or dolphin? Each type has an optimal time for doing everything from going to bed and drinking coffee, to having sex and making decisions.  He also discusses the best and worst sleeping positions, managing insomnia, how temperature affects sleep, and the effects of caffeine, alcohol, and cannabis.
